Transaction e3fc2610a931f2d5866f64b839a4b30736d84efc937ea0f247b9dd50376097b5
1 Input
1 Output
-
e3fc2610a931f2d5866f64b839a4b30736d84efc937ea0f247b9dd50376097b5:0
- value
- 513134
- script pubkey
- OP_0 OP_PUSHBYTES_20 48d47c05b3f96cb740e0b5a228af2289a0c2f10c
- address
- bc1qfr28cpdnl9ktws8qkk3z3tez3xsv9ugvs5vkpk